Output 8bd84ac396033f7de38bcdea8ed6953fddbc175d8e8553ba51ead0b080fb4223:2

value
112150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99393efbec343de82301fc743d9615351177b396 OP_EQUAL
address
3FfBtRBmMLYd9wYkdp7ry4mcLPwytMZyd4
transaction
8bd84ac396033f7de38bcdea8ed6953fddbc175d8e8553ba51ead0b080fb4223
spent
true